使用 Masterify REST API 自动化您的母带处理工作流程。所有请求都需要 头。
https://api.masterify.netREST API · Webhook · Pro 及以上
所有 API 请求都需要 Bearer 令牌认证。请在控制台设置页面创建 API 密钥。 密钥格式: + 32 位十六进制。
curl -H "Authorization: Bearer aim_live_a1b2c3d4e5f6g7h8i9j0k1l2m3n4o5p6"
| 套餐 | API 密钥 | 频率限制 | Webhooks |
|---|---|---|---|
| free | 1 个 | 5 次/分钟 | 1 |
| starter | 3 个 | 30 次/分钟 | 5 |
| pro | 5 个 | 60 次/分钟 | 10 |
| studio | 10 个 | 120 次/分钟 | ∞ |
/api/v1/master上传音频文件并创建母带处理任务。文件须为 MP3/WAV/FLAC 格式,最大 50MB,不超过 10 分钟。
| 名称 | 类型 | 必填 | 说明 |
|---|---|---|---|
| file | File | Yes | 音频文件 (MP3, WAV, FLAC) |
| platforms | string | Yes | 逗号分隔的平台: spotify, apple_music, youtube, melon, soundcloud |
| genre | string | No | 风格: kpop, edm, ballad, hiphop, pop, other (默认: other) |
| ai_service | string | No | AI 服务: suno, udio, elevenlabs, other (默认: other) |
| tier | string | No | 母带处理级别: standard, premium (默认: standard) |
| webhook_url | string | No | 任务完成时的回调 URL (per-job) |
| reference_file | File | No | 参考音轨 (用于音色匹配) |
{
"job_id": "550e8400-e29b-41d4-a716-446655440000",
"status": "queued",
"platforms": ["spotify", "apple_music"],
"credits_used": 1,
"credits_remaining": 19
}所有错误以相同格式返回:
{
"error": {
"code": "INSUFFICIENT_CREDITS",
"message": "크레딧이 부족합니다."
}
}| HTTP | 代码 | 说明 |
|---|---|---|
| 400 | FILE_TOO_LARGE | 文件大小超过 50MB |
| 400 | UNSUPPORTED_FORMAT | 仅支持 MP3、WAV、FLAC |
| 400 | FILE_TOO_LONG | 文件超过 10 分钟 |
| 400 | INVALID_PLATFORM | 无效的平台 |
| 402 | INSUFFICIENT_CREDITS | 积分不足 |
| 429 | CONCURRENT_LIMIT | 超过并发处理上限 |
| 401 | INVALID_API_KEY | 无效的 API 密钥 |
| 429 | RATE_LIMIT | 请求频率超限 |
3 步开始您的第一次母带处理。
控制台 → 设置 → 创建 API 密钥
aim_live_a1b2c3d4...
通过 POST /api/v1/master 上传文件
curl -X POST .../v1/master \ -H "Authorization: Bearer ..." \ -F "[email protected]" \ -F "platforms=spotify"
当 status=done 时下载
GET /api/v1/jobs/{id}/download有疑问? 落地页 API 部分查看更多信息。